Global Business News Roundup
The Justice Department is considering going to court to block the merger of Northwest Airlines and Continental Airlines, citing antitrust concerns. Meanwhile, Dell has made a profit of $260 million from selling 2% of his company's holdings, while Hyundai has won the rights to take over Kia Motors Corp after outbidding Ford and two domestic competitors. In Brazil, factories are struggling to pay workers their year-end bonuses, with some considering paying in goods instead of cash.
